This report presents the findings of field tests of a seniors' survey completed by 417 older persons living in ten small communities in three different regions of Canada: the Central Kootenay Regional District in British Columbia; Wellington and Perth counties in Ontario; and Kings county in Nova Scotia. It provides a detailed description of the respondents socio-demographic characteristics, health and functional status, their housing and living arrangements as well as their need for support services.
